First, I removed the old broken handle, rivets and placed the cleaver in a rust remover. After this process, I put it in a bucket with warm water and soda to neutralize the cleaning process with acid. Washed and dried.
Due to the fact that the entire back of the mesh was raised due to bumps, I used a chisel to remove large burrs.

Next, with the help of a sanding machine, I corrected the edges of the cleaver, and also made new bevels for it. The surface was not sanded, but only cleaned of dark spots and small scratches. Next, I sanded the cutting edge and slightly sharpened the blade.

The next step is the handle. I chose beech and steel rivets. After processing the handle, I soaked it with a special homemade paste for wood. Well, there hasn't been a test for a long time, today is the day. Enjoy watching, thank you for your attention! Smile right now!
